undefined

Margy O’Herron

Senior expert with the Liberty & National Security Program at NYU’s Brennan Center for Justice, focusing on immigration enforcement practices and legal oversight.

The AI-powered Podcast Player

Save insights by tapping your headphones, chat with episodes, discover the best highlights - and more!
App store bannerPlay store banner
Get the app